Taiwan | 2010-2014

Slope Rehabilitation, Ten-Ren Temple, Miaoli, Taiwan

Products:ACEGrid® GG

Application: Slope Stabilization

Background

To achieve an ideal leisure living environment, and at the same time prevent slope landslides caused by torrential rain, determining how to conserve soil and water as well as provide a proper drainage system became a very important task for the Miaoli County Government.

Problem / Task

The slope at the site was unstable and the drainage system also has been improperly installed. Therefore, every time torrential rain fell, it caused landslides endangering the buildings and safety of nearby residents.

Solution/ Design & Construction

Based on a careful evaluation, the designer introduced a 2-stage mechanically stabilized earth (MSE) retaining wall combined with vegetative facing. The total height of the wall was approximately 13 m. The two reinforcing materials applied were ACEGrid® geogrid GG150-I and GG200-I. In addition, the horizontal and vertical drainage system was built to drain the water properly to the detention pond, thereby preventing flooding and hydraulic destructions. The detention pond also can be served for irrigation and scenery later.

Result

The project not only successfully minimized the uses of materials and construction time, but also greatly reduced carbon emission. As a result, a sound retaining structure with durability and aesthetic green landscape was built. A few months after the completion of the project, the area was affected by numerous typhoons and torrential rains. Nevertheless, the MSE wall and drainage system remained in good condition.
